Solution
1. Preparation
  • Gather necessary tools: BMW key fob or remote.
  • Ensure all doors are closed and the vehicle is in a safe environment.
2. Turn On Ignition
  • Insert the key fob into the ignition slot or press the start/stop button without the brake pedal pressed to enter accessory mode (ignition on but engine off).
3. Access the Service Menu
  • Use the iDrive controller to navigate:
    • Select "Menu" on the iDrive screen.
    • Go to "Vehicle Info" or "Service Required."
    • Choose "Service History."
4. Reset the Service Light
  • Highlight the service item you wish to reset (e.g., oil service, brake service).
  • Press and hold the controller button until a confirmation message appears.
  • Confirm the reset action when prompted.
5. Turn Off Ignition
  • Turn off the ignition by pressing the start/stop button or turning the key to the off position.
